Troop 5 is pleased to announce that Cameron M. has earned the P.R.A.Y. Four Star Award.

Cameron’s Four Star journey was launched at the Duty to God Weekend at Camp Rainey Mountain in Northeast Georgia Council, BSA. Cameron continued at Camp Rainey Mountain to complete the first three awards. The last award, God and Life, was taught by Jim Gallagher at Troop 5’s hut.
